Large language models are running into limits in domains that require an understanding of the physical world — from robotics to autonomous driving to manufacturing. That constraint is pushing investors toward world models, with AMI Labs raising a $1.03 billion seed round shortly after World Labs secured $1 billion.Large language models (LLMs) excel at processing abstract knowledge through next-token prediction, but they fundamentally lack grounding in physical causality.
